Apple releases MacBook Pro EFI Firmware Update 1.8

Apple Online StoreApple today released MacBook Pro EFI Firmware Update 1.8 which eliminates the noise made by the optical disk drive during system startup and wake from sleep on MacBook Pro computers.

When installation is complete, please run Software Update again, and install SuperDrive Firmware Update 3.0.

MacBook Pro EFI Firmware Update 1.8 is available via Software Update and also as a standalone installer.
